Identifying Characteristics and Common Varieties

The wild robin, specifically the American robin (Turdus migratorius), is a relatively large songbird with a familiar silhouette. Adult robins typically measure between 9 and 11 inches in length, with a wingspan of around 17 inches. Their plumage is easily recognizable: a reddish-orange breast, dark gray to black back and head, and white markings on the wings and belly. Young robins, however, sport a speckled breast that gradually transforms to the vibrant orange hue as they mature. There are subtle regional variations in size and coloration, and observing these nuances can be a fascinating pursuit for dedicated birdwatchers.

While the American robin is the most commonly encountered species, several other robin-like birds can sometimes be mistaken for it. For instance, the European robin (Erithacus rubecula) sports a bright red breast and face, differing significantly in appearance. Variations within the American robin lineage also occur; some populations show a paler orange breast or a more pronounced gray head. Careful attention to detail, including the bird’s size, shape, and specific markings, is vital for accurate identification.

The Influence of Habitat and Diet on Appearance

A robin’s diet significantly influences its overall health and appearance. Primarily insectivores during the breeding season, they consume caterpillars, beetles, and other invertebrates, providing essential proteins for themselves and their developing chicks. In fall and winter, their diet shifts to include berries and fruits, contributing to seed dispersal and ensuring the health of plant communities. A well-nourished robin will exhibit brighter, more vibrant plumage, while a bird struggling to find food may appear duller and less robust. The availability of food sources, therefore, directly impacts the visual characteristics we observe.

Similarly, the type of habitat can influence a robin's behavior and appearance. Robins dwelling in forested areas might be more cautious and secluded, while those in suburban environments may be bolder and more accustomed to human presence. Variations in cover, such as dense shrubs or open lawns, also influence foraging strategies and subsequent body condition. Understanding these ecological factors provides valuable context when observing these birds in their natural environments.

Behavioral Patterns and Vocalizations

Wild robins exhibit a range of fascinating behaviors, particularly during the breeding season. The male robin is known for its tireless efforts to establish and defend a territory, singing a complex and varied song to attract a mate and ward off rivals. This song is often described as a cheerful warble, but it can also include harsher scolding calls when the robin feels threatened. Observing these interactions provides insights into the social dynamics of these birds. Furthermore, robins are known for their characteristic “hop-and-pause” foraging style, scanning the ground for worms and insects.

Beyond mating displays, robins engage in a variety of other interesting behaviors. They often pull worms from the ground with a distinctive tugging motion, and they are known to bathe frequently, fluffing their feathers to maintain cleanliness and insulation. They also exhibit a remarkable ability to adapt to different environments, thriving in both rural and urban settings. This adaptability contributes to their widespread distribution and enduring popularity among birdwatchers.

Decoding Robin Song and Calls

A robin's vocalizations are far more complex than they initially appear. The song, used primarily to attract mates and defend territory, consists of a series of phrases that can vary considerably depending on the individual bird and the surrounding environment. Researchers have identified regional dialects in robin songs, suggesting that birds learn their songs from other robins in their local area. Understanding these nuances requires careful listening and a keen ear for detail.

In addition to the song, robins also produce a variety of calls used for different purposes. A "churring" sound often indicates alarm, while a sharp "tut" can be used to scold intruders. They also emit soft, clicking sounds during foraging, presumably to communicate with their mates and young. Learning to recognize these different calls can provide valuable insights into the robin's emotional state and intentions.

Nesting and Raising Young

Wild robins are renowned for their meticulously crafted nests. Typically constructed in shrubs or low trees, the nests are cup-shaped and made from mud, grass, twigs, and lined with soft materials such as feathers and animal hair. The female robin undertakes the majority of the nest-building, while the male provides materials and defends the surrounding area. The entire process can take several days, resulting in a durable and well-camouflaged structure. The location of the nest is also carefully chosen, offering protection from predators and the elements.

A typical robin clutch consists of 3 to 5 bluish-green eggs, which are incubated by the female for approximately 12 to 14 days. Once hatched, the young robins, known as fledglings, are entirely dependent on their parents for food and care. Both parents work tirelessly to feed their offspring, bringing them a steady supply of insects and worms. After about two weeks, the fledglings leave the nest, but they continue to rely on their parents for several more weeks as they learn to forage and fend for themselves. Observing this parental care is a heartwarming aspect of birdwatching.

Common Threats to Robin Nests and Strategies for Protection

Despite their diligent efforts, robin nests are vulnerable to a variety of threats. Predators, such as snakes, cats, and raccoons, can raid nests and prey on eggs or young birds. Habitat loss and degradation also pose significant challenges, reducing the availability of suitable nesting sites. Human disturbance, such as accidental trampling or excessive noise, can also disrupt nesting activities and lead to nest failure.

Fortunately, there are several steps that homeowners can take to protect robin nests. Avoiding the use of pesticides can help maintain a healthy insect population, providing a reliable food source for robins. Planting native shrubs and trees can create suitable nesting habitat, and keeping cats indoors can prevent them from preying on birds. Respecting nesting areas by maintaining a safe distance and avoiding unnecessary disturbance is also crucial for ensuring successful reproduction.

  1. Provide natural nesting materials: Leave twigs, grasses, and leaves in your yard.
  2. Protect nests from predators: Keep cats indoors and secure bird feeders.
  3. Avoid pesticides: Maintain a healthy insect population for foraging.
  4. Maintain a safe distance: Minimize disturbance around nests.

By implementing these simple measures, we can create a more welcoming environment for wild robins and contribute to their conservation.

The Role of Wild Robins in Garden Ecosystems

The presence of wild robins in a garden indicates a healthy and thriving ecosystem. As insectivores, they play a vital role in controlling populations of harmful pests, such as caterpillars and beetles, which can damage plants. They also contribute to seed dispersal by consuming berries and fruits, helping to propagate native plant species. Their foraging activities help aerate the soil, improving drainage and promoting healthy root growth. In essence, robins act as natural gardeners, contributing to the overall health and vitality of the landscape.

Furthermore, the presence of robins can attract other beneficial wildlife to the garden. Their foraging activities can stir up insects that are then preyed upon by other birds. The seeds they disperse can provide food for a variety of animals. Creating a robin-friendly garden, therefore, benefits not only the robins themselves but also the entire ecosystem. Encouraging biodiversity through thoughtful landscaping practices is a crucial step towards creating a sustainable and resilient garden.

Expanding Our Understanding of Robin Migration and Future Research

While the American robin is often considered a year-round resident, many populations engage in partial migration, moving shorter distances in response to changing food availability and weather conditions. Tracking these movements has become increasingly sophisticated in recent years, thanks to the use of tiny GPS trackers and banding studies. These studies are revealing a complex and dynamic pattern of migration, challenging previous assumptions about robin behavior. Learning about these movements helps us better understand their ecological needs.

Ongoing research is also focused on understanding the impacts of climate change on robin populations. Changes in temperature and precipitation patterns are affecting the timing of breeding, the availability of food, and the distribution of suitable habitat. Continued monitoring and research are essential for assessing these impacts and developing effective conservation strategies. Citizen science initiatives, such as bird counts and nest monitoring programs, provide valuable data that can inform these research efforts, demonstrating that everyone can play a role in protecting these cherished birds.
